Vale Park · Suburb / Locality
Who lives here — how many people, how old they are, and how communities identify.
A noticeably older population marks Vale Park, where the typical resident is 42. This community of 2,452 people is older than the national figure by four years and has a higher proportion of seniors than most similar areas.

How the population splits across age groups.
Seniors aged 65 and over make up 21.5% of the area, which is well above the national figure of 17.2%. Children under 15 account for 16.0%, a little below the state average.

First Nations identity and marital status.
Married couples are common here at 57.1%, while the 6.7% of people in de facto relationships is well below both the state and national figures. Only 0.4% of residents identify as Aboriginal or Torres Strait Islander.
